Creamy Spaghetti Pie

PREP TIME
20 min
COOKING TIME
50 min
TOTAL TIME
70 min
SERVINGS
6 servings

Ingredients
- butter for greasing
- 1 (6 ounce) package spaghetti
- 1/3 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 2 eggs, beaten
- 2 tablespoons butter
- 1 pound lean ground beef
- 1/2 cup chopped onion
- 1/4 cup chopped green bell pepper
- 1 clove garlic, minced
- 1 (14.5 ounce) can diced tomatoes
- 1 (6 ounce) can tomato paste
- 1 teaspoon white sugar
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- 1 cup cottage cheese
- 1/2 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
Instructions
1
Preheat your oven to the desired temperature of 350 degrees Fahrenheit (175 degrees Celsius).
2
Next, take a small amount of butter and grease a 10-inch pie plate to prevent the dish from sticking.
3
In a separate pot, bring a substantial amount of water to its boiling point and add a pinch of salt. Cook spaghetti in the boiling water, stirring occasionally, until it reaches your desired level of tenderness yet still maintains some firmness to the bite, approximately 12 minutes.
4
Drain the spaghetti through a colander and return it to its original pot.
5
Meanwhile, combine Parmesan cheese, beaten eggs, and another small amount of butter in the pot with the spaghetti. Stir until everything is well incorporated.
6
Form the spaghetti mixture into a crust shape in the prepared pie plate and set it aside for now.
7
In a large skillet, heat it up over medium-high heat. Cook and stir the beef, onion, bell pepper, and garlic in the hot skillet until the beef becomes crumbly and browned, taking around 5 to 7 minutes.
8
Drain off any excess fat that may have accumulated and stir in the undrained tomatoes, tomato paste, sugar, and oregano. Continue cooking, stirring occasionally, until everything is heated through.
9
Now, spread a layer of cottage cheese over the spaghetti crust. Then, pour in the beef-tomato mixture.
10
Finally, place your dish in the preheated oven and bake for 20 minutes.
11
Sprinkle a layer of mozzarella cheese over the top of your pie and continue baking until the cheese is melted, taking around 5 minutes more.
